Item 1.01 Entry into a Material Definitive Agreement.

On May 26, 2012, Colfax Corporation (“Colfax”) entered into a Share Purchase Agreement (the “Agreement”) with Inversiones Breca S.A. (“Inversiones Breca”), pursuant to which Colfax will acquire an approximately 91% interest in Soldex S.A. (“Soldex”), a corporation organized under the laws of Peru that supplies welding products from its plants located in Peru and Colombia. The transaction values Soldex at $235 million, including the assumption of debt. Colfax’s 91% interest will consist of 147,005,547 Soldex common shares and 55,810,902 Soldex investment shares. The purchase price of $183,351,461 for the 91% interest in Soldex is subject to adjustment based upon changes in Soldex’s net equity, defined as the difference between total assets and total liabilities, between February 29, 2012 and the date of the closing of the transactions contemplated by the Agreement.

The obligation of the parties to consummate the transactions contemplated by the Agreement is subject to certain conditions, including the accuracy of the other party’s representations and warranties (subject to certain materiality qualifications) and compliance by the other party with its covenants under the Agreement. Inversiones Breca’s obligation to consummate the transactions is also subject to Colfax obtaining the approval of the Superintendencia de Industria y Comercio (the “SIC”) of the Republic of Colombia, which is the primary antitrust regulator of Colombia, to indirectly acquire two Soldex subsidiaries that are located in Colombia.

The Agreement provides that the closing of the transactions will take place on the last day of the month in which the SIC’s approval is received or, if such approval is received within the last five business days of a month, on the last day of the following month. After the closing of the transactions, Colfax will commence a tender offer under Peruvian law for all voting shares held by Soldex’s minority shareholders.

The foregoing description of the Agreement is qualified in its entirety by reference to the full text of the Agreement, which is attached as Exhibit 2.1 to this report.
